Vistry and Kier Property have acquired a residential site on Laindon Road, Billericay, on which they intend to deliver 250 homes.
Half of the homes will be affordable, comprising both affordable rent and shared ownership options, alongside homes for private sale.
Developed in close collaboration with Basildon Council, the scheme will create a sustainable neighbourhood that enhances the local area.
